The books were brilliant, the movies were good, but the video games have not been as spectacular as the source material. That looks like it’s about to change with the release of Hogwarts Legacy.
The game doesn’t come out until February 10, but it’s already the #1 game on multiple sales charts thanks to pre-orders. Hogwarts Legacy takes place a century before the events in the books, and the cinematic trailer just released gives a couple of brief hints at what to expect – including a mention of a Weasley! Actor and comedian Simon Pegg leads an impressive voice cast as he portrays Headmaster Phineas Nigellus Black.
According to the official website, Hogwarts Legacy “is an immersive, open-world action RPG set in the world first introduced in the Harry Potter books. For the first time, experience Hogwarts in the 1800s. Your character is a student who holds the key to an ancient secret that threatens to tear the wizarding world apart. Now you can take control of the action and be at the center of your own adventure in the wizarding world. Your legacy is what you make of it.”
